Autor
|
Tema: 50 números enteros introducidos por teclado (Leído 5,084 veces)
|
douglascarvallo
Desconectado
Mensajes: 5
|
#include <stdio.h> #include <conio.h> main () { int i, num, suma; suma=0;
for (i=1;i<=50;i++) { printf ("Ingrese el dato numerico %d: ", i); scanf ("%d", &num);
suma=suma+num; } printf ("\n La suma de los numeros enteros es: %d", suma); getch (); return 0; }[/quote]
¿COMO HACER PARA QUE EL PROGRAMA MUESTRE EL RESULTADO A MEDIDA QUE SE SUMEN?
|
|
« Última modificación: 23 Junio 2013, 06:47 am por douglascarvallo »
|
En línea
|
|
|
|
engel lex
|
ya en el otro post que hiciste dejaste en el codigo como mostrar un mensaje cada vez que el ciclo pasa... pista: "cout"
por otro lado... no uses mayúsculas... es equivalente a gritar -.-
|
|
|
En línea
|
El problema con la sociedad actualmente radica en que todos creen que tienen el derecho de tener una opinión, y que esa opinión sea validada por todos, cuando lo correcto es que todos tengan derecho a una opinión, siempre y cuando esa opinión pueda ser ignorada, cuestionada, e incluso ser sujeta a burla, particularmente cuando no tiene sentido alguno.
|
|
|
leosansan
Desconectado
Mensajes: 1.314
|
¿COMO HACER PARA QUE EL PROGRAMA MUESTRE EL RESULTADO A MEDIDA QUE SE SUMEN?
Uppss, me zumban los oídos con tanto grito.
Sencillamente "mete" el printf a continuación de cada scanf:#include <stdio.h> #include <conio.h> int main () { int i=0, num=0, suma=0; for (i=1;i<=3;i++) { printf ("Ingrese el dato numerico %d: ", i); scanf ("%d", &num); while (getchar()!='\n'); suma+=num; printf ("\n La suma es: %d \n", suma); } getch (); return 0; }
Sólo indicarte un par de cositas. La función main tiene un return 0, luego debes declararla como int. Y en cuanto al uso de la librería conio y la función getch léete lo que no hay que hacer en C/C++
|
|
|
En línea
|
|
|
|
rir3760
Desconectado
Mensajes: 1.639
|
Otro detalle a tener en consideración: cuando se envía una cadena a la salida estándar y esta no termina con el carácter de avance de linea '\n' se debe llamar a la función fflush para así garantizar que el texto realmente se envié y no termine en el bufer de la salida estándar. En este caso: printf ("Ingrese el dato numerico %d: ", i );
Un saludo
|
|
|
En línea
|
C retains the basic philosophy that programmers know what they are doing; it only requires that they state their intentions explicitly. -- Kernighan & Ritchie, The C programming language
|
|
|
douglascarvallo
Desconectado
Mensajes: 5
|
Gracias pos sus consejos respuestas, me han ayudado muchísimo.
|
|
|
En línea
|
|
|
|
|
Mensajes similares |
|
Asunto |
Iniciado por |
Respuestas |
Vistas |
Último mensaje |
|
|
Creación de objetos con nombres introducidos por teclado
Java
|
NelxoN
|
4
|
4,617
|
16 Mayo 2009, 18:18 pm
por Amerikano|Cls
|
|
|
Necesito ayuda, validación de números enteros
Programación C/C++
|
DarkSorcerer
|
3
|
4,944
|
25 Noviembre 2013, 20:37 pm
por do-while
|
|
|
Multiplicar los numeros introducidos en los nodos de una lista.
Programación General
|
danndres
|
0
|
2,044
|
5 Diciembre 2013, 05:36 am
por danndres
|
|
|
Error al comparar 2 numeros introducidos a traves de un textbox[SOLUCIONADO]
.NET (C#, VB.NET, ASP)
|
01munrra
|
3
|
3,210
|
10 Abril 2016, 06:09 am
por 01munrra
|
|
|
Como guardar productos nuevos introducidos desde teclado? java
Java
|
ibai92
|
7
|
5,948
|
12 Marzo 2018, 15:07 pm
por ibai92
|
|